Alkhorayef Water and Power Technologies Company (TADAWUL:2081)
Saudi Arabia flag Saudi Arabia · Delayed Price · Currency is SAR
121.50
-4.80 (-3.80%)
At close: Feb 19, 2026

TADAWUL:2081 Ratios and Metrics

Millions SAR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
4,2535,2504,8403,4852,560-
Market Cap Growth
-21.00%8.47%38.88%36.13%--
Enterprise Value
4,8405,5935,2323,8652,703-
PE Ratio
16.4022.8334.5732.4424.78-
PS Ratio
1.712.692.884.244.50-
PB Ratio
4.786.769.008.777.18-
P/FCF Ratio
-50.62----
P/OCF Ratio
-26.871304.23109.28--
EV/Sales Ratio
1.952.873.114.704.75-
EV/EBITDA Ratio
13.8215.8921.0722.4420.20-
EV/EBIT Ratio
16.8818.8126.0028.1824.01-
EV/FCF Ratio
-25.4553.92----
Debt / Equity Ratio
1.100.901.021.280.620.40
Debt / EBITDA Ratio
2.691.982.192.941.640.88
Debt / FCF Ratio
-6.76---2.79
Net Debt / Equity Ratio
0.660.490.891.070.510.13
Net Debt / EBITDA Ratio
1.621.081.932.461.350.28
Net Debt / FCF Ratio
-3.093.65-9.54-2.60-1.650.89
Quick Ratio
1.141.071.151.261.822.34
Current Ratio
1.361.281.431.482.072.79
Asset Turnover
0.950.981.210.850.881.09
Return on Equity (ROE)
32.67%35.01%29.95%28.50%31.77%44.75%
Return on Assets (ROA)
7.14%9.35%9.05%8.85%10.84%15.32%
Return on Capital Employed (ROCE)
19.40%29.60%28.40%22.80%24.30%30.90%
Earnings Yield
6.10%4.38%2.89%3.08%4.04%-
FCF Yield
-4.47%1.98%-1.03%-4.69%-4.27%-
Dividend Yield
1.44%1.02%-1.10%3.08%-
Payout Ratio
20.25%--69.81%36.29%17.55%
Total Shareholder Return
1.44%1.02%-1.10%3.08%-
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Utility template. Financial Sources.